The House of Gucci Movie 2021: A Saga of Greed and Glamour

*House of Gucci* isn't just a biographical crime drama; it’s a meticulously crafted tapestry woven with threads of ambition, betrayal, and the intoxicating allure of wealth and power. The film follows the tumultuous journey of Patrizia Reggiani, a captivating and complex character brought to life by Lady Gaga with a mesmerizing blend of vulnerability and chilling determination. From her humble beginnings, Patrizia's relentless pursuit of a life of luxury leads her to Maurizio Gucci (Adam Driver), the grandson of Guccio Gucci, the founder of the iconic fashion house. Their marriage, initially a fairytale of romance and social climbing, quickly descends into a battle for control, fueled by Patrizia's insatiable greed and Maurizio's wavering affections.

The film masterfully portrays the internal struggles within the Gucci family. The intricate web of relationships, rivalries, and betrayals is meticulously detailed, showcasing the clash between old-world Italian traditions and the changing landscape of the fashion industry in the late 20th century. Scott's direction, known for its visual flair, creates a world of extravagant parties, lavish villas, and high-stakes business dealings, all contributing to the film's captivating atmosphere. The costumes, a crucial element in depicting the Gucci aesthetic and the characters' evolving social status, are breathtaking, reflecting the opulence and extravagance associated with the brand.

Patrizia Gucci: The Serpent in the Garden of Gucci

Patrizia Reggiani, the central figure of the narrative, is a fascinatingly ambiguous character. While the film doesn't shy away from portraying her manipulative and ruthless actions, it also offers glimpses into her vulnerabilities and the complex motivations driving her ambition. Lady Gaga’s performance transcends simple villainy; she embodies Patrizia's charisma, her intelligence, and her chilling capacity for cruelty. The actress’s dedication to the role, including her meticulous research and transformation, is evident in her nuanced portrayal of a woman driven by a desire for power and recognition, even if it means sacrificing everything and everyone in her path.

The film doesn't shy away from portraying Patrizia's flaws. She is shown as manipulative, materialistic, and ultimately responsible for the tragic events that unfold. However, Gaga's performance allows for empathy, even if only fleetingly, for a woman caught in a web of her own making. The film raises questions about the nature of ambition, the corrosive effects of wealth, and the devastating consequences of unchecked desire. Patrizia's story is not simply a cautionary tale; it’s a complex exploration of human nature and the dark side of the pursuit of the "Italian Dream."
